L-741,494, a fungal metabolite that is an inhibitor of interleukin-1 beta converting enzyme.

Abstract

gamma-Pyrone-3-acetic acid (L-741,494) is a novel metabolite produced by a culture of the fungal genus Xylaria. This substance is a water-soluble, competitive, irreversible inhibitor of Interleukin-1 beta Converting Enzyme that is inactive against papain and trypsin. It has a mol wt of 154 and an empirical formula of C7H6O4. We propose the name xylaric acid for this compound.
